Job Title: QA Automation Engineer
Location: Fully remote, with infrequent travel to Newport, South Wales
Salary: Β£40,000 per annum + Benefits
Contract Type: Contract, 6 months
About the Role:
We are working with an industry-leading PropTech company to assist them in finding a QA Automation Engineer to join their growing IT and Development team.
This role offers the opportunity to play a key role in developing and maintaining automation frameworks, automating web and API testing, and integrating tests into CI/CD pipelines . The company fosters a high-performing yet collaborative and fun work culture, providing exciting career development opportunities in a cutting-edge technology environment.
Key Responsibilities:
- Develop and maintain automation frameworks for web and API testing.
- Automate test cases using Selenium WebDriver, Java, TestNG/JUnit, and Maven .
- Integrate automated tests into CI/CD pipelines using tools such as AWS CodePipeline, Jenkins, or GitHub Actions .
- Conduct cross-browser and cross-platform testing using tools like LambdaTest or BrowserStack .
- Write efficient, scalable, and maintainable code following best practices.
- Perform debugging and root cause analysis to resolve issues.
- Collaborate with development teams to ensure high-quality deliverables .
- Generate test reports and maintain documentation.
Key Skills and Experience:
- At least 3 yearsβ experience in QA automation.
- Expertise in automation tools and frameworks , including Selenium WebDriver, Java, TestNG/JUnit, and Maven .
- Proficiency in Java, JavaScript, and Node.js , with a strong understanding of OOP principles .
- CI/CD & DevOps experience , including AWS CodePipeline, Jenkins, or GitHub Actions .
- Familiarity with cross-browser testing using LambdaTest or BrowserStack .
- Experience with API testing & automation , using tools such as Postman or RestAssured .
- Proficiency in version control using Git, GitHub, or Bitbucket .
- Knowledge of software testing best practices , including SOLID, DRY, POM, and Data-Driven Testing .
- Strong debugging and troubleshooting skills , including log analysis and exception handling.
- Excellent problem-solving, analytical thinking, and communication skills .
Nice-to-Have Skills:
- Experience with JMeter for performance testing.
- Familiarity with AWS services and cloud-based testing environments.
What Our Client Offers:
- Flexible working β Fully remote role with occasional office visits.
- Generous leave policies β Including additional leave for your birthday month.
- Health and wellbeing benefits β Company sick pay and access to employee discount schemes.
- Career development opportunities β Ongoing training, development, and recognition programs.
- Professional development support β Full support for AWS training and certification programs.
- Collaborative and fun work environment β Regular team-building activities and charity fundraising events.
Working Hours:
Monday to Friday, 9 am β 5 pm.
If you are passionate about QA automation and technology and eager to contribute to a dynamic, innovative team , we would love to hear from you!
Contact Detail:
PYVITAL Recruiting Team